2. Hazards Identification
space
DANGER -- CORROSIVE
Emergency Overview
May cause chemical burns to eyes and skin.
May cause sensitisation by skin contact.
May cause chronic toxic effects.
space
Potential short term health effects
Eye, Skin contact, Skin absorption, Inhalation, Ingestion.
Routes of exposure
space
May cause chemical burns. May cause blindness.
Eyes
space
May cause chemical burns. May cause skin sensitization, an allergic reaction, which
Skin
becomes evident on re-exposure to this material.
space
Harmful if inhaled. May cause respiratory tract irritation or chemical burns.
Inhalation
space
Harmful if swallowed. May cause chemical burns to mouth, throat and stomach.
Ingestion
space
Eyes. Respiratory system. Skin.
Target organs
space
Prolonged or repeated exposure to dilutions can cause drying, defatting and dermatitis.
Chronic effects
space
The product may cause burns to eyes, skin and mucous membranes.
Signs and symptoms

3. Composition/Information on Ingredients
space
Ingredient(s) CAS # Percent
Quaternary ammonium compounds, benzyl-C8-18-alkyldimethyl, chlorides 63449-41-2 1-5
Formaldehyde 50-00-0 1-5
1,3-Propanediol, 2-(hydroxymethyl)-2-nitro- 126-11-4 15 - 40
space
Not applicable to DIN or PCP products. Refer to product label for active ingredient
Composition comments
content.

4. First Aid Measures
space
First aid procedures
Immediately flush with cool water. Remove contact lenses, if applicable, and continue
Eye contact
flushing for 15 minutes. Obtain medical attention if irritation develops or persists.
space
Immediately flush with water. Wash with soap and water. Obtain medical attention if
Skin contact
irritation persists.
space
If symptoms develop move victim to fresh air. If symptoms persist, obtain medical
Inhalation
attention.
#8283 Page 1 of 5 Issue date 06-Jul-2009
space
Do not induce vomiting. If vomiting occurs naturally, have victim lean forward to reduce
Ingestion
risk of aspiration. Never give anything by mouth if victim is unconscious, or is
convulsing. Obtain medical attention.
space
Symptoms may be delayed.
Notes to physician
space
If you feel unwell, seek medical advice (show the label where possible). Ensure that
General advice
medical personnel are aware of the material(s) involved, and take precautions to protect
themselves. Show this safety data sheet to the doctor in attendance.

6. Accidental Release Measures
space
Keep unnecessary personnel away. Do not touch or walk through spilled material. Do
Personal precautions
not touch damaged containers or spilled material unless wearing appropriate protective
clothing. Keep people away from and upwind of spill/leak.
space
Stop leak if you can do so without risk. Prevent entry into waterways, sewers,
Methods for containment
basements or confined areas.
space
Before attempting clean up, refer to hazard data given above. Small spills may be
Methods for cleaning up
absorbed with non-reactive absorbent and placed in suitable, covered, labelled
containers. Prevent large spills from entering sewers or waterways. Contact emergency
services and supplier for advice. Never return spills in original containers for re-use.
.
7. Handling and Storage
space
Use good industrial hygiene practices in handling this material. Do not get this material
Handling
in your eyes, on your skin, or on your clothing.
space
Keep out of the reach of children. Store in a cool (<30癈), dry, well ventilated area away
Storage
from incompatible materials and animal feedstuffs.

11. Toxicological Information
space
Component analysis - LC50
Ingredient(s) LC50
1,3-Propanediol, 2-(hydroxymethyl)-2-nitro- Not available
Formaldehyde 0.578 mg/l/4h rat
Not available
Quaternary ammonium compounds,
benzyl-C8-18-alkyldimethyl, chlorides
#8283 Page 3 of 5 Issue date 06-Jul-2009
space
Component analysis - Oral LD50
Ingredient(s) LD50
1,3-Propanediol, 2-(hydroxymethyl)-2-nitro- 1900 mg/kg mouse; 1900 mg/kg rat
Formaldehyde 100 mg/kg rat
240 mg/kg rat; 150 mg/kg mouse
Quaternary ammonium compounds,
benzyl-C8-18-alkyldimethyl, chlorides
space
Effects of acute exposure
May cause chemical burns. May cause blindness.
Eye
space
May cause chemical burns. May cause skin sensitization, an allergic reaction, which
Skin
becomes evident on re-exposure to this material.
space
Harmful if inhaled. May cause respiratory tract irritation or chemical burns.
Inhalation
space
Harmful if swallowed. May cause chemical burns to mouth, throat and stomach.
Ingestion
space
Contains a potential skin sensitizer.
Sensitisation
space
Prolonged or repeated inhalation of low concentrations may cause irreversible effects to
Chronic effects
respiratory tract.
space
Contains a potential carcinogen.
Carcinogenicity
ACGIH - Threshold Limit Values - Carcinogens
Formaldehyde 50-00-0 A2 - Suspected Human Carcinogen
IARC - Group 1 (Carcinogenic to Humans)
Formaldehyde 50-00-0 Monograph 88 [2006], Monograph 62 [1995], Supplement 7 [1987]
U.S. - California - Proposition 65 - Carcinogens List
Formaldehyde 50-00-0 carcinogen, initial date 1/1/88 (gas)
space
Contains a potential mutagen.
Mutagenicity
space
Non-hazardous by WHMIS criteria.
Reproductive effects
space
Contains a potential teratogen.
Teratogenicity

12. Ecological Information
space
Components of this product have been identified as having potential environmental
Ecotoxicity
concerns.
Ecotoxicity - Freshwater Fish Species Data
Formaldehyde 50-00-0 96 Hr LC50 Pimephales promelas: 22.6-25.7 mg/L [flow-through]; 96 Hr LC50 Lepomis
macrochirus:1510 g/L [static]; 96 Hr LC50 Brachydanio rerio:41 mg/L [static]; 96 Hr
LC50 Oncorhynchus mykiss:0.032-0.226 ml/L [flow-through]; 96 Hr LC50 Oncorhynchus
mykiss:100-136 mg/L [static]; 96 Hr LC50 Pimephales promelas:23.2-29.7 mg/L [static]
Ecotoxicity - Microtox Data
Formaldehyde 50-00-0 5 min EC50 Photobacterium phosphoreum: 9.0 mg/L; 15 min EC50 Photobacterium
phosphoreum: 7.26 mg/L; 25 min EC50 Photobacterium phosphoreum: 6.81 mg/L; 30
min EC50 Photobacterium phosphoreum: 16.5 mg/L; 1 Hr EC50 Vibrio harveyi: 1.2 mg/L;
5 Hr EC50 Vibrio harveyi: 3.7 mg/L; 72 Hr EC50 Colpoda aspera: 5.39 mg/L
Ecotoxicity - Water Flea Data
Formaldehyde 50-00-0 96 Hr EC50 water flea: 20 mg/L; 48 Hr EC50 Daphnia magna: 2 mg/L
space
Harmful to aquatic life.
Environmental effects
